The K3NG Keyer is a highly regarded, open-source iambic keyer project based on the Arduino architecture (typically the ATmega328P microcontroller). It offers extensive features, including memories, winkeyer emulation, and LCD support. However, the schematic is often realized as a loose collection of modules (Arduino Uno + LCD Keypad Shield + Audio Module).

VE3XYZ (fictitious callsign), a retired EE. The Goal: A field-day keyer with memory banks and a 4-line LCD. The Problem: Original schematics from 2017 showed conflicting pin assignments for the LCD’s RS and E pins. The Solution: He downloaded a “Repack 2024” from Groups.io that included a color-coded wiring diagram for the HD44780 LCD in 4-bit mode. The repack also consolidated the 5V regulator circuit (LM7805) onto the same sheet. The Result: From printing to first CW contact: 3 hours. No magic smoke.
